How much do online pastor j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for online pastor in the United States is $60,902.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45,000.00 and $69,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an online pastor do?

An Online Pastor provides spiritual guidance, community engagement, and ministry support in a digital environment. They lead online services, interact with members through social media and live chats, and offer pastoral care through emails, video calls, and messaging platforms. Their role also includes creating faith-based content, coordinating virtual small groups, and fostering digital discipleship. The goal is to ensure that individuals feel connected, supported, and spiritually nurtured, regardless of their physical location.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an online pastor?

To thrive as an Online Pastor, you need a background in pastoral ministry, theological training, and experience providing spiritual care, ideally supported by seminary education or relevant certification. Familiarity with livestream platforms, social media management tools, and video conferencing systems is important for delivering sermons and engaging with online congregants. Strong communication, empathy, digital engagement, and organizational skills distinguish outstanding candidates in this role. These abilities are essential for fostering a vibrant, connected community and providing meaningful support in a virtual church environment.

What are common challenges faced by online pastors and how can they be managed?

Online Pastors often face challenges such as building deep connections with congregants in a virtual setting and maintaining engagement across digital platforms. Managing various technologies, navigating time zone differences, and addressing pastoral care needs from a distance can also be complex. Successful Online Pastors typically overcome these challenges by fostering active participation through interactive content, using secure communication channels, and setting clear expectations for online gatherings. Ongoing training and collaboration with digital ministry teams can further help adapt to evolving technology and congregational needs.

McKinleyville Baptist Church (McKinleyville, CA) - Pastor
The Big Picture
McKinleyville Baptist Church (mckinleyvillebaptist.com) is seeking a full-time Pastor who will preach expository, Christ-centered sermons and help our church body continue to grow in loving God and one another.We are a loving Bible-believing fellowship that has served the Northern California Coast for more than 55 years.We believe the Word of God is our supreme authority in faith and life.Our faithful congregation is committed to reaching our community, as well as the rest of the world, for Christ.Our Sunday morning attendance typically ranges between 40 - 70.
Requirements
Responsibilities:
• Provide overall direction and planning for worship services
• Preach weekly expository sermons on Sunday morning
• Coordinate other ministries and gatherings including Sunday evenings and mid-week Bible studies
• Provide spiritual leadership in all areas of church life and function
• Provide pastoral care to members including visitations, counseling, discipleship, prayer, funerals, etc.
Qualifications:
• Pastoral experience: Prior ministry experience preferred
• Education: Minimum of a bachelor's degree in Bible/theology.A Master's degree from an accredited seminary preferred
• Spiritual Gifts: Preaching, teaching, shepherding, leadership
Benefits
Compensation & Benefits:
• Salary Package: Annual total package of $55,000 - $65,000, depending on experience
• Allocation: Salary package can be configured in various ways depending on the preference of our new Pastor so as to optimize income tax ramifications
• Vacation: 3 weeks
